About the method

The method is based on spectral analysis, the study of the microelement composition of hair using mass spectroscopy. In this way, health disorders can be detected at an early stage when they cannot be diagnosed in other ways.
Thanks to the results of the hair mineral analysis, the specialist can draw conclusions about the following:
  • deficiency or excess of macro- and microelements in the body;
  • the presence of chronic and micronutrient-related diseases and metabolic disorders;
  • correspondence of nutrition to the characteristics and needs of a particular organism;
  • the degree of influence of bad habits on human health;
  • safety indicators of the environment in which the patient lives;
  • the effectiveness of the prescribed treatment course of supplements.
The accuracy of the spectral analysis method is due not only to the high sensitivity of modern medical devices, but also to the fact that hair accumulates trace elements, and spectral analysis of the content of elements in the hair shows the result over the last 3-6 months, in contrast to blood and other substrates.
Based on the data obtained, it is possible to draw up an accurate picture of the microelement status of any organism, adjust the diet or select the necessary supplements for treatment, while the patient does not need to come to the clinic in person. Diagnostics is carried out remotely using a strand of hair sent to the laboratory. The patient will get a specialist consultation online.
